Cousin Libbie Cole Spanish Relish

6 large cucumbers

2 large onions

4 quarts green tomatoes

2 heads cabbage

6 green peppers

2 red peppers, chop, add 1 cup salt; let stand over night, drain.  1 large bunch celery, then add;

1 oz. white mustard seed

½ oz. celery seed

1 oz. ground mustard

¼ oz. turmeric

2 lbs. brown sugar

Cover with vinegar & boil slowly 20 minutes. 

Take out seeds of cucumber if large, you can use small ones.

Oven temperatures are seldom given in the old books and recipes; most times the only say something like a slow oven or quick oven.  These are the equlivent to today’s oven temperatures;

A very slow oven equals 250 to 275 degrees.

A slow oven equals 300 to 325 degrees.

A moderate oven equals 350 to 375 degrees.

A hot or quick oven equals 375 to 400 degrees.

A very hot oven equals 400 to 450 degrees.
